Every little kid has a dream job when they grow up. For me, it was being a missionary. I always grew up wishing I was a missionary kid sharing God’s love in the safari of Africa. As I got older though, society told me I needed a “real” job that provided enough money for a comfortable life.

           So I went to college on and off taking subjects that would hopefully spark an interest as a potential career. But none did. I still had an desire that drew me to the mission field. I wanted a life with purpose. A life outside the boundaries of the “American Dream”. I wanted to share what I believed with people all around the world and share with them the hope that has changed my life. 

           This April I was praying to God for direction. I didn’t know if I should move, continue college, or join the mission field. I felt God really put YWAM (Youth With A Mission) on my heart and I grew more and more excited. I was finally pursuing a path that had been on my heart since I was a child!

         I applied to YWAM and started the process but was soon hit with doubts and fear. I had no money saved up and with two years left of a car payment there was no way I would be able to afford to go. So I gave into my doubts and decided not to go. 

         But God had other plans. Three weeks before the school I applied for started, I got a message from a friend in YWAM. She shared how much God provided for her and people she knew. She told me that finances were the last thing that should keep me from pursuing the path God has called me to. So I took a leap of faith. 

            I finished my application process and got accepted into the school! I had just enough money to buy a last minute flight and a visa. I was unable to sell my car but my uncle lent me the money to cover my car payments for the 6 months I was gone (totally a last minute God thing!).After 50+ travel hours with 24 hours in the LAX airport because my visa didn’t go through I made it to Australia. God has provided so much already just to be here and it has been a crazy journey of faith and trust so far!

             I have never had to trust God 100% and because of that I have always been slightly independent from God. I have never had to rely on Him financially. But in this season He is asking me to completely rely on Him and His provision. So I am letting go of my pride and learning to trust in my Father for everything. 

           I still have tuition costs as well as the cost for outreach. My team and I are going to Nepal and we will be working with locals and sharing the gospel through skits and dances. We will be working with children as well as backpackers. I am so excited to see what God will do with and through our team as well as with the Nepali people.
